As part of a bold step to eradicate persistent communication barriers within healthcare, the expert team at GLOBO Language Solutions has introduced GLOBO KAI. This is an artificial intelligence (AI)-driven interpreter, which was designed explicitly to aid healthcare providers in bridging the gaps in communication. Designed as an extension of the current GLOBO Connect platform, the new solution is a real-time, on-demand language interpretation service that enables government agencies and employees to communicate in more than 20 languages. The introduction of GLOBO KAI marks a tremendous step in offering quality, affordable, and convenient language services to patients all around (particularly the Limited English Proficiency (LEP) patients who are usually the most vulnerable in healthcare settings.

In early 2025, the technology began a multi-site pilot program that encompassed providers throughout Illinois, Louisiana, and Michigan.

The other intriguing factor about KAI is that it is an integration hybrid within the larger GLOBO sense-making ecosystem. Instead of taking over the role of human interpreters, KAI supplements the human in-person, telephonic, and video-based interpretation services. This mixed system covers the case when complex, emotionally charged, and/or sensitive conversations are present. Additionally, a small part of daily administrative contacts can be easily delegated to KAI, thus providing interpreters with the maximum availability where they are needed most.
